How much does it cost to rent a home in Baltimore?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Baltimore 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,849 | $830 | $10,000+ |
Baltimore 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,133 | $700 | $8,500 |
Baltimore 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,594 | $650 | $10,000+ |
Baltimore 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,101 | $600 | $6,900 |
Baltimore 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,803 | $650 | $5,850 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Baltimore
What type of rentals are currently available in Baltimore?
There are currently 2885 Apartments for Rent in Baltimore, MD with pricing that ranges from $600 to $9,317. There are also 1343 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Baltimore ranging from $450 to $26,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Baltimore?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Baltimore ranges from $450 to $26,500 with an average monthly rent of $2,647.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Baltimore?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Baltimore range from $1,020 to $5,556,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$700 to $8,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$650 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$850.
